The global LED Area Lighting market is currently undergoing a massive transformation, driven by the Industrial 4.0 movement and the urgent need for sustainable energy solutions. As the primary choice for illuminating large spaces such as parking lots, industrial warehouses, sports arenas, and urban streetscapes, LED technology has moved beyond simple "bulb replacement." Today, it is the backbone of smart city infrastructure.
From North America to Europe and the burgeoning markets in Southeast Asia, the industrial sector is transitioning from legacy HID (High-Intensity Discharge) and HPS (High-Pressure Sodium) systems to high-performance LED solutions. This shift is not just about energy savings—which often exceed 60-70%—but also about reducing maintenance costs, improving visibility for safety, and integrating with IoT (Internet of Things) frameworks.

Modern LED Area Lights now achieve up to 180lm/W, significantly outperforming traditional lighting while maintaining a lower heat signature.
Motion sensors, daylight harvesting, and wireless dimming are no longer "options" but standard requirements for intelligent facility management.

Eco-friendly materials and reduction in light pollution are at the forefront of urban development standards.
Smart poles and area lights are becoming hubs for 5G transceivers and surveillance equipment in smart city grids.
Customized beam angles (Type III, Type IV, Type V) ensure light is directed exactly where needed, reducing glare and waste.
